Lot 6482
ISLAMIC, Ottoman Empire. Mustafa III, AH 1171-1187 / AD 1757-1774. 40 Para (Silver, 38 mm, 14.70 g, 12 h), Egypt, AH 1171 = 1757/8. Tughra of Mustafa III. Rev. ‘ʿAlī / ḍuriba fī / Miṣr / sana / 1171’ (‘Ali. Struck in Egypt (in the year) 1171’ in Arabic). KM-117. Extremely rare. Areas of weakness and with suspension loop attached, otherwise, very fine.

From the collection of Dr. D. Löer, ex Solidus E-Auction 75, 23 March 2021, 357.

Ali Bey was a Mamluk leader in Egypt who rebelled against the Ottoman Empire and ruled independently as Mustafa III.
